Task 1 : Topoq raohic Survev GCW will perform field and offlce services, utilizing ground and aerial methods, to provide design- grade topography ofthe above-described area, as needed forengineering. Surveywill include location of above{round utilities, and inverts on manholes and water nut elevations in the adjacent area, if any. We propose to provide the services described above for a Lump Sum Fee of $9,520. Task 2: Gradinq GCW will prepare a Grading Plan to analyze site constrainls, earthwork balance, and stormwater conveyance. The Grading Plan will be prepared in conjunction with and will accompany the Technical Drainage Study as part of the Technical Drainage Study submittal package. The Grading Plan will be prepared per local agency Public Works requirements and other applicable codes. ltem includes preparatjon of street cross section and other grading-related details. ln addition, the Grading Plan for the OHV & MX Track will be designed per the recommendations as shown in the drainage study from Dyer Engineering Consultants dated June 11,2019. A title sheet, general notes, and quantities sheet. Construction quantities, construction notes, and additional details for clarification will also be provided. 2. Precise grading and paving plans for on-site development. These plans will identify the fine grading elevations along street centerlines and curb lines, top-of-curb elevations, pad elevations, finished floor elevations, and grade breaks. These plans will also reflect surface drainage and driveways. Grading details and cross-sections at property lines, retaining walls, berms, and street cross- sections are included in this task. Retaining walls will be shown horizontally with vertical information. However, structural design and calculations of the retaining walls are not included in this fee proposal. 3. Grading plan detail and cross sections sheets. 4. Prepare plan and profile for all interior streets. This task includes a profile of the storm drain. The plan and profile sheets will be prepared per local agency Standards. 5. Prepare horizontal control plans. 6. Prepare the Bond and Fee Estimate Form.
